Understanding Hydrogen Peroxide: Your Deep Cleaning Ally
At its core, hydrogen peroxide (H2O2) is deceptively simple: it’s essentially water (H2O) with an extra oxygen molecule. But it’s this extra oxygen that makes all the difference, transforming it into a potent oxidizing agent. When hydrogen peroxide comes into contact with organic material like germs, dirt, or stains, it releases that extra oxygen molecule, creating a vigorous fizzing action. This process, known as oxidation, effectively breaks down the cell walls of bacteria, viruses, fungi, and mold spores, neutralizing them and lifting away grime.
One of the most appealing aspects of hydrogen peroxide for deep cleaning is its breakdown process. After it performs its magic, it decomposes into harmless water and oxygen, leaving behind no harsh chemical residues. This makes it a preferred choice for surfaces where you want to avoid chemical buildup, such as food preparation areas or children’s toys. For most household cleaning tasks, a standard 3% hydrogen peroxide solution, readily available at drugstores and supermarkets, is perfectly sufficient and safe when used correctly. Higher concentrations are typically for industrial use and should be avoided for home applications.
The benefits of incorporating hydrogen peroxide into your deep cleaning arsenal are extensive. It acts as a powerful disinfectant, effectively sanitizing high-touch surfaces. It’s a natural deodorizer, eliminating unpleasant smells rather than just masking them. Furthermore, its oxidizing power makes it an excellent stain remover and brightener for a variety of materials, providing a gentler alternative to chlorine bleach in many scenarios.
The Versatility of Hydrogen Peroxide: Applications for Every Corner
From the busiest hub of your kitchen to the quietest corners of your home, hydrogen peroxide proves its worth as a multi-purpose deep cleaning agent. Its diverse applications mean you can often reach for just one bottle instead of many, simplifying your cleaning cabinet.
Kitchen Powerhouse
The kitchen, a breeding ground for bacteria, benefits immensely from hydrogen peroxide’s sanitizing capabilities.
- Countertops and Cutting Boards: After preparing food, spray a 3% hydrogen peroxide solution directly onto countertops and cutting boards (plastic, wood, or marble). Let it sit for 5-10 minutes to disinfect, then rinse thoroughly, especially for surfaces that contact food. This helps eliminate common foodborne bacteria like Salmonella and E. coli.
- Sinks and Drains: For a sparkling white sink and to tackle lingering odors, sprinkle baking soda generously over the basin, then pour hydrogen peroxide over it. Scrub with a brush, rinse, and wipe dry. For drains, pouring a cup of peroxide down regularly can help break down grime and deodorize.
- Dishwashers and Garbage Cans: To combat mold, mildew, and funky odors in dishwashers, place about a quarter cup of peroxide on the top rack and run a high-heat cycle while empty. For garbage cans, spray the inside with a peroxide-water solution after emptying, allowing it to air dry, preferably in the sun, for a fresh, clean scent.
- Cookware and Baking Sheets: For baked-on food, mix hydrogen peroxide with baking soda to form a paste. Apply it to the affected areas, let it sit overnight, then scrub away. A few drops in dishwashing soap can also boost handwashing effectiveness.
Bathroom Brilliance
The moist environment of bathrooms is ideal for mold, mildew, and germs. Hydrogen peroxide is a formidable foe against these common bathroom woes.
- Showers, Bathtubs, and Grout: Spray hydrogen peroxide directly onto shower walls, tubs, and liners to kill fungi and mildew. For stubborn stains and to brighten dull grout, mix peroxide with baking soda to create a powerful scrubbing paste. Apply, scrub, and rinse for gleaming surfaces.
- Toilets: Pour half a cup of 3% hydrogen peroxide into the toilet bowl, let it sit for up to 30 minutes, then scrub and flush. This not only sanitizes but also brightens the bowl.
- Mirrors and Glass: For streak-free mirrors and glass surfaces, spray them with a 1:1 solution of hydrogen peroxide and water, then wipe with a lint-free cloth or newspaper.
Laundry & Fabric Care
Hydrogen peroxide can also rejuvenate your fabrics, making it an excellent addition to your laundry routine.
- Stain Removal: Before tossing stained garments into the wash, test hydrogen peroxide on an inconspicuous spot for colorfastness. If safe, pour a small amount directly onto the stain (wine, food, grass, blood), let it fizz for a minute, then dab and rinse with cold water or wash as usual.
- Whitening Dingy Whites: Boost the brightness of your whites without harsh bleach by adding one cup of hydrogen peroxide to your washing machine during the wash cycle. It sanitizes and refreshes simultaneously.
Beyond the Basics
The utility of hydrogen peroxide extends far beyond kitchens and bathrooms.
- Flooring: For various types of flooring, including hardwood, tile, vinyl, laminate, and concrete, dilute hydrogen peroxide with water and either mop or spray the solution directly onto the floor. Wipe clean and dry immediately to prevent water damage.
- Houseplants: If your plants are suffering from fungus (like root rot) or pests, spray affected areas with a mixture of one part hydrogen peroxide to three or four parts water. It can also sanitize pruning tools to prevent disease spread.
- Kids’ Toys: For non-battery-operated toys, soak them in a tub of equal parts peroxide and water for a few minutes, then rinse with clean water to sanitize. For electronic toys, wipe carefully with a cloth dipped in the solution.
- Sponges and Cleaning Tools: To kill lingering bacteria on sponges, soak them weekly in a 50/50 peroxide-water solution for 10-20 minutes, then rinse and air dry. This method also works for makeup brushes, tweezers, and other hygiene tools.
- Mattresses: For those with dust mite allergies, mix one part peroxide with one part water in a spray bottle and lightly spritz your mattress. Allow it to fully dry before making the bed.
- Humidifiers and Dehumidifiers: Monthly, run a solution of equal parts hydrogen peroxide and water through these machines to remove mold and mildew, improving your home’s air quality.
Mixing and Application Guidelines for Effective Deep Cleaning
To maximize the deep cleaning power of hydrogen peroxide and ensure safety, follow these application best practices. The goal is to allow the peroxide sufficient “dwell time” to work, but also to understand when and how to dilute and rinse.
- General Disinfection (Surfaces): For everyday disinfecting of hard surfaces like countertops, doorknobs, and light switches, a common and effective approach is to create a 1:1 ratio solution by mixing equal parts 3% hydrogen peroxide with water in a spray bottle. Spray the surface generously, allowing the solution to sit for at least five to ten minutes. This contact time is crucial for the oxidation process to effectively kill germs. Afterward, wipe the surface clean with a cloth. For food-contact surfaces, a thorough rinse with clean water is also recommended.
- For Tough Stains, Grime, and Grout: Hydrogen peroxide truly shines when paired with a mild abrasive. A popular and highly effective method is to create a paste using hydrogen peroxide and baking soda. The abrasive quality of baking soda helps lift stubborn grime, while the peroxide breaks down stains and whitens. Apply the paste directly to the stained area (grout lines, bathtub rings, carpet spots), let it sit for 15-30 minutes, then scrub with a brush or sponge. Rinse thoroughly once clean.
- Laundry Brightening and Stain Pre-Treatment: For boosting whites, add one cup of 3% hydrogen peroxide directly to your washing machine drum along with your detergent before starting a cycle. For pre-treating fabric stains, apply a small amount of undiluted 3% hydrogen peroxide directly to the stain. Let it fizz and work for a few minutes (ensure you’ve patch-tested first!), then proceed with your regular wash cycle.
- Contact Time is Key: Regardless of the application, avoid wiping off hydrogen peroxide immediately. Its effectiveness as a disinfectant and stain remover relies on sufficient contact time with the target surface. Refer to specific application recommendations for optimal dwell times, typically ranging from 5 to 30 minutes.
- Always Rinse: While hydrogen peroxide breaks down into water and oxygen, it’s good practice to rinse surfaces after deep cleaning, especially those that come into direct contact with food or skin. This ensures any remaining loosened debris or trace elements are washed away, leaving a truly clean finish.

Essential Safety Precautions for Hydrogen Peroxide Use
While hydrogen peroxide is generally considered a safer and more environmentally friendly alternative to some harsher chemical cleaners, it is still a powerful chemical and requires careful handling. Adhering to safety precautions is paramount to prevent accidents and ensure a positive cleaning experience.
- Always Wear Protective Gear: When working with hydrogen peroxide, even the common 3% solution, it’s wise to protect your skin and eyes. Wear protective gloves to prevent skin irritation, especially with prolonged contact, and safety goggles to shield your eyes from splashes.
- Ensure Adequate Ventilation: Always use hydrogen peroxide in a well-ventilated area. Opening windows or running exhaust fans helps dissipate any released oxygen or fumes, preventing inhalation of concentrated vapors, especially in enclosed spaces like bathrooms.
- NEVER Mix with Other Cleaners: This is a critical rule. Hydrogen peroxide should never be mixed with certain other cleaning agents, as it can create dangerous and potentially toxic reactions.
- Bleach (Sodium Hypochlorite): Mixing creates highly corrosive peracetic acid and can release toxic chlorine gas.
- Vinegar: While often used in a two-step cleaning process (applied separately), mixing them directly can create peracetic acid, a corrosive chemical that can irritate the skin, eyes, and respiratory system.
- Ammonia: Combining can form a corrosive mixture.
- Rubbing Alcohol: Mixing can create volatile compounds.
- Always use hydrogen peroxide on its own or specifically as directed in trusted recipes (e.g., with baking soda or dish soap, which are generally safe combinations).
- Test on Inconspicuous Areas: Before applying hydrogen peroxide to a large or visible surface, always perform a patch test in a small, hidden area. Hydrogen peroxide can have a bleaching effect and may lighten or damage certain fabrics, natural stones (like marble or granite), aluminum, and some hardwood finishes. Observing the reaction ensures compatibility and prevents unintended damage.
- Proper Storage is Crucial: Store hydrogen peroxide in its original, opaque container in a cool, dark place, away from direct sunlight, heat sources, and organic materials. Exposure to light and heat can cause it to break down rapidly and lose its potency. Keep it out of reach of children and pets.
- Avoid Ingestion and Direct Contact with Skin/Eyes: Hydrogen peroxide is not for internal consumption and can cause gastrointestinal irritation if ingested. If accidental ingestion occurs, seek medical attention. In case of contact with eyes or sensitive skin, rinse immediately and thoroughly with plenty of water for at least 15 minutes. If irritation persists, consult a doctor.
- Not for Open Wounds: Contrary to past beliefs, medical professionals now discourage using hydrogen peroxide on open wounds or cuts. It can damage healthy tissue and slow down the healing process.

Hydrogen Peroxide vs. Other Cleaners: A Quick Comparison
When considering hydrogen peroxide for deep cleaning, it’s helpful to understand how it stacks up against other common household cleaners. This comparison highlights its unique advantages and specific applications.
Hydrogen Peroxide vs. Bleach
- Effectiveness: Both are potent disinfectants. Bleach is often considered stronger for killing a broader spectrum of heavy-duty bacteria and viruses quickly. Hydrogen peroxide is also highly effective but may require slightly longer contact times for full disinfection, especially at its common 3% concentration.
- Safety & Residue: Hydrogen peroxide breaks down into harmless water and oxygen, leaving no toxic residue. This makes it a preferred choice for food-contact surfaces and in homes with children or pets, where chemical residues are a concern. Bleach, on the other hand, can leave behind chemical fumes and residues that require thorough rinsing and can be irritating to the respiratory system and skin.
- Fumes & Odor: Hydrogen peroxide is virtually odorless, making it much more pleasant to work with than the strong, pungent fumes associated with bleach.
- Bleaching Action: Both can lighten fabrics and surfaces. Hydrogen peroxide offers a gentler bleaching action, making it suitable for refreshing whites without the harshness of chlorine bleach, though a patch test is still vital.
- Mixing: As stressed, never mix hydrogen peroxide with bleach.
Hydrogen Peroxide vs. Vinegar
- Disinfecting Power: Hydrogen peroxide is a stronger oxidizer and a more effective disinfectant against a wider range of bacteria, viruses, and fungi than vinegar. Vinegar, while acidic and capable of killing some pathogens and dissolving mineral deposits, is not considered a broad-spectrum disinfectant by health organizations.
- Mechanism: Hydrogen peroxide works through oxidation, attacking cellular structures. Vinegar works by lowering pH levels, creating an environment inhospitable to some microbes.
- Residue & Fumes: Both break down into relatively harmless components, though vinegar leaves a distinct, temporary acidic smell. Hydrogen peroxide is odorless.
- Mixing: While they are both useful natural cleaners, never mix hydrogen peroxide and vinegar in the same container. This combination can create peracetic acid, a corrosive and irritating substance. However, they can be used sequentially (e.g., spray with vinegar, then spray with peroxide after a dwell time and wipe) for enhanced sanitization on some surfaces, but this method requires careful understanding and is generally not recommended for everyday use due due to the risk of accidental mixing. For most deep cleaning, using them independently or choosing one for specific tasks is safer and sufficient.

Frequently Asked Questions
Can hydrogen peroxide go down the drain?
Yes, diluted hydrogen peroxide solutions, typically the 3% concentration used for household cleaning, are generally safe to pour down the drain. In fact, it can even help to clean and deodorize drains without causing harm to plumbing or the environment as it breaks down into water and oxygen.
Do you need to wear gloves when handling hydrogen peroxide?
While 3% hydrogen peroxide is relatively mild, it is highly recommended to wear protective gloves, such as disposable latex or nitrile gloves, to protect your skin from irritation, especially during prolonged contact or if you have sensitive skin. It’s also wise to wear eye protection to guard against splashes.
What happens when you mix dish soap with hydrogen peroxide?
Mixing dish soap with hydrogen peroxide is generally safe and can be a very effective combination for tackling tough stains on laundry, carpets, or even cleaning cookware. The dish soap acts as a surfactant, helping to lift grease and grime, while the hydrogen peroxide provides its oxidizing and stain-fighting power.
Is hydrogen peroxide safe for all surfaces?
No, hydrogen peroxide is not safe for all surfaces. While it’s excellent for many, it can cause discoloration or damage to delicate materials. Always perform a patch test on an inconspicuous area before applying it to natural stone (like marble or granite), certain hardwood finishes, aluminum, or dyed fabrics and carpets, as it has bleaching properties.
Does hydrogen peroxide expire or lose its effectiveness?
Hydrogen peroxide doesn’t truly “expire” in the traditional sense, but it does gradually decompose into water and oxygen over time, especially when exposed to light, heat, or air. This means it loses its potency and effectiveness. Storing it in its original opaque bottle in a cool, dark place helps preserve its strength for longer, typically maintaining efficacy for about 1-3 years after opening.
